Tools for Correlation and Regression Analyses in Estimating a Functional Relationship of Digitalization Factors

Digitalization processes affect all levels and spheres of human activities, from personal communications to public events. The widespread implementation of digital technologies has an ambiguous effect on the personal, social, and economic paths of modern society’s development. At the moment, there is no single approach to the estimation of digitalization’s impact, particularly on the financial and economic properties of a company. The objective of this study was to create multiple models for the assessment of digitalization’s impact on company performance. To accomplish this objective, the following steps were performed: conducting a literature survey on the experience with digital technologies’ implementation; selecting the most appropriate mathematical tools for correlation and regression analyses; determining a functional relationship between the factors and consequences of digitalization in terms of companies’ performance; identifying digitalization factors, risks, and their impact on the financial sustainability of companies; and creating a multiple regression model of the functional relationship between digitalization factors and the financial sustainability of companies. In the course of the study, a correlation analysis of the dependence of companies’ financial sustainability on a number of digitalization factors has been conducted, and different ways of using company performance data as effective features and predictive factors are offered. The article includes sampling data on the parameterization and quality evaluation of multiple regression models. The validity of the multiple models suggested was tested with actual statistical data obtained from 16 Russian companies. The application of the multiple regression model was devised to estimate digitalization’s impact on companies’ performance, and their financial sustainability can be seen as the most important practical implication of this study.
